Montgomery County, Mississippi


Montgomery County is one of the 82 county of Mississippi, located towards the Southern Region (East South Central) of United States. It is home to over 12189 people (2000 census). As of July 2008, the estimated population of the county is 11266, giving it the 15th smallest population among Mississippi's county. The county has a total area of 407.86 square miles (1056.35 kmē), of which, 406.85 square miles (1053.74 kmē) of it is land and 1.02 square miles (2.64 kmē) of it is water, makes it the fourth smallest by total area in Mississippi.

As of the census of 2000, there were 12189 people in the county, organized into 4690 households, and 3369 families residing in the county. The population density was 30 people per square mile (11.58/kmē), it is Mississippi's 55th most densely populated county. There were 5402 housing units at an average density of 13.3 per square mile (5.14/kmē). The average household size was 2.57 people, and the average family size was 3.1 people. In the county the population was spread out, with 26.8% under the age of 18, 8.9% from 18 to 24, 25.3% from 25 to 44, 22.4% from 45 to 64, and 16.7% who were 65 or older. For every 100 males there were 115.7 females. For every 100 males age 18 and over, there were 123.3 females. According to July 2008 Census Bureau estimates, the population of the county is 11266, The racial or ethnic makeup of the county was 6023 White, 5144 Black or African American, 12 American Indian, 34 Asian, 3 Native Hawaiian, and 50 from two or more races.

The median income for a household in the county was $25270, making it the 55th highest county by median household income in Mississippi. The median income for a family in the county was $31602, it is the 49th wealthiest county in terms of median family income. The per capita income for the county was $14040, making it the 42nd wealthiest county by per capita income among the Mississippi.

In 2000, 3213 pupils and students, of which 48.4% are male and 51.6% are female, 26.36% of the total population, are in the education system. Of which, percentage of enrollment student are in, 7.78% nursery or pri school, 4.73% kindergarten, 53.19% elementary school, 23% high school and 11.3% College graduate school.
